    A great barista is leaving the championship stage! For over four years, he hasn't missed a Swiss Barista final. With wit, passion, and meticulousness, he always delivered perfectly!

    Michel is certainly one of the best in his field. Reason enough to look back and revisit some special moments. In 2013, a young chef appeared on the championship stage. At that time, he had started as an external sales representative for a larger roastery about a year earlier.

    External sales representative? Yes, that's Michel Aeschbacher. And probably one of the best out there for coffee. Hardly anyone is as successful as him.

    How does that happen? This young man's secret recipe isn't really a recipe but... authenticity.

    And: Michel is perhaps the most enthusiastic person I know! When he takes on a topic, a cause, an idea – he does so with fire and passion.

    Michel's passion is unparalleled. Four times in recent years, Michel told me about his planned championship presentations, and each time with such unrestrained joy, enthusiasm, and conviction that I would have wanted to fill out the score-sheet with sixes and give it back.

    In 2013, Michel came 5th in his debut. In 2014, only Nina Rimpl narrowly edged him out. His Aeropress-Shisha show remains unforgettable. The narrative tension of that presentation is unparalleled.

    In 2015, Emi Fukahori and Felix Hohlmann battled it out at the top, and Michel came 3rd with a top-class field behind him. His performance and technical perfection earned him the highest score ever given at a Swiss championship from the judges.
